Abstract

A method and system for creating and editing video and/or audio tracks is described. The method includes providing at least one artist, venue, and track available for selection and providing at least one clip associated with the at least one artist, venue, and track. The method also includes allowing a user to create a custom track from the at least one clip. The system includes a plurality of video cameras for recording a live performance at a plurality of positions. The system also includes at least one server for storing a plurality of video clips created from the plurality of video cameras and an application stored on the at least one server for allowing a user to access the plurality of video clips via the Internet.

Claims (24)

1. A method for creating a custom track, the method comprising:

providing a first menu listing at least one value for selection by a user from a first category, the first category comprising one of artists, venues, shows, or songs;

populating, based at least in part on a selection from the first menu by the user, a second menu with at least one value from a second category, the second category comprising another one of artists, venues, shows, or songs that is associated with the selection from the first menu;

providing at least two pre-recorded video clips and an audio track associated with the selections made by the user; and

allowing the user to create a custom track from the at least two pre-recorded video clips and the audio track, wherein changes to only the audio track by the user are subject to third party preapproved parameters.

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the first category is artists, and the second category is available venues at which the selected artist has performed.

3. The method of claim 2 , further comprising:

populating, based at least in part on the selection by the user of a venue from the second menu, a third menu with at least one available show performed by the selected artist at the selected venue.

4. The method of claim 3 , further comprising:

populating, based at least in part on the selection by the user of a show from the third menu, a fourth menu with at least one available song performed by the selected artist during the selected show.

5. The method of claim 2 , further comprising:

populating, based at least in part on the selection by the user of a venue from the second menu, a third menu with at least one available song performed by the selected artist at the selected venue.

6. The method of claim 2 , further comprising:

populating, based at least in part on the selection by the user of a venue from the second menu, a third menu with at least one available show performed by the selected artist at the selected venue.

7. The method of claim 1 , further comprising:

prior to selection of an artist from the first menu, providing a list of individuals to the user for selection, the first menu being populated with artists associated with the selected individual.

8. The method of claim 1 , wherein the first category is venues, and the second category is available artists that have performed at the selected venue.

9. The method of claim 8 , further comprising:

populating, based at least in part on the selection by the user of an artist from the second menu, a third menu with one of at least one available song or at least one available show performed by the selected artist at the selected venue.

10. The method of claim 1 , wherein the first category is artists, and the second category is one of available songs or available shows which the selected artist has performed.

11. The method of claim 1 , wherein the first category is songs, and the second category is one of available venues at which the selected song has been performed.

12. The method of claim 1 , wherein the first category is songs, and the second category is available shows during which the selected song has been performed.

13. The method of claim 1 , further comprising:

prior to providing the at least two video clips and the audio track, providing a menu listing available camera angles associated with selections made by the user.
